GroupDocs.Search for Node.js via Java

یافتن متن در اسناد تجاری

GroupDocs.Search for Node.js via Java قابلیت جستجوی قدرتمند و منعطفی را برای اسناد فراهم می‌کند. جستجوی متن را به راحتی در برنامه‌های Node.js یکپارچه کنید.

چگونه در اسناد PDF جستجو کنیم

GroupDocs.Search جستجوی متن در اسناد PDF را برای برنامه‌های Node.js via Java ساده و کارآمد می‌سازد.

  1. یک دایرکتوری برای ذخیره ایندکس جستجو ایجاد کنید.
  2. پوشه‌ای که شامل اسناد است را انتخاب کنید.
  3. گزینه‌های جستجو را برای شامل کردن فقط فایل‌های PDF تنظیم کنید.
  4. جستجو را اجرا کنید و نتایج را بازیابی کنید.
const searchLib = require('@groupdocs/groupdocs.search')

// یک دایرکتوری برای ذخیره ایندکس جستجو تعیین کنید
const index = new searchLib.Index("c:/MyIndex");

// پوشه‌ای که شامل اسناد قابل جستجو است را مشخص کنید
index.add("c:/MyDocuments");

// جستجو را به فرمت‌های خاص فایل محدود کنید
const options = new searchLib.SearchOptions();
options.SearchDocumentFilter = 
    searchLib.SearchDocumentFilter.createFileExtension(".pdf");

// نتایج جستجو را بازیابی و پردازش کنید
const result = index.search("Lorem");
npm i @groupdocs/groupdocs.search
برای کپی کلیک کنید
کپی شد
مثال‌های بیشتر مستندات

قابلیت‌های جستجوی پیشرفته

GroupDocs.Search for Node.js via Java کارآیی جستجوی اسناد را با ایندکس‌گذاری بیش از 70 فرمت فایل بهبود می‌بخشد. با استفاده از تکنیک‌های جستجوی پیشرفته، بازیابی محتوا را بهینه‌سازی کنید.

ویژگی‌های کلیدی GroupDocs.Search

جستجوی جامع متن

متن را در قالب‌های سند محبوب مانند PDF، فایل‌های Word، صفحات گسترده و ارائه‌ها استخراج و پیدا کنید. از جستجوی تقریبی، هم‌صداها و کوئری‌های wildcard پشتیبانی می‌کند.

ایندکس‌گذاری بهینه برای عملکرد

با ایجاد ایندکس‌های قابل استفاده مجدد، جستجوها را تسریع کنید. این ویژگی سرعت و کارآمدی را هنگام کار با مجموعه‌های بزرگ اسناد افزایش می‌دهد.

پشتیبانی از چند زبان

در بیش از 80 زبان به جستجو در اسناد بپردازید. برای دقت بیشتر، چیدمان‌های صفحه کلید و واریانت‌های کلمات را شناسایی می‌کند.

گزینه‌های جستجوی قابل تنظیم

نتایج جستجو را با فیلترها، عبارات منظم، حساسیت به حروف بزرگ و سایر تنظیمات انعطاف‌پذیر به دقت تنظیم کنید.

فیلتر کردن اسناد قابل جستجو

با نحوه بهبود جستجوهای سند با استفاده از فیلترها آشنا شوید.

JavaScript

const searchLib = require('@groupdocs/groupdocs.search')

// یک ایندکس را برای استثنا کردن فرمت‌های فایل نامطلوب پیکربندی کنید
IndexSettings settings = new IndexSettings();
DocumentFilter fileExtensionFilter = 
  searchLib.DocumentFilter.createFileExtension(".odp", ".png", ".rtf");

DocumentFilter invertedFilter = 
  searchLib.DocumentFilter.createNot(fileExtensionFilter);
settings.setDocumentFilter(invertedFilter);

Index index = new searchLib.Index("c:/MyIndex", settings);
    
// دایرکتوری حاوی اسناد را مشخص کنید
index.add("c:/MyDocuments");

// خروجی جستجو را برای استفاده‌های بعدی پردازش کنید
const result = index.Search("Lorem", options);

// خروجی جستجو را برای استفاده‌های بعدی پردازش کنید
console.log('Documents: ' + result.getDocumentCount());
console.log('Occurrences: ' + result.getOccurrenceCount());
npm i @groupdocs/groupdocs.search
برای کپی کلیک کنید
کپی شد
مثال‌های بیشتر مستندات

GroupDocs.Search چیست؟

GroupDocs.Search for Node.js via Java یک کتابخانه جستجو و ایندکس‌گذاری قوی است که امکان بازیابی سریع متن در اسناد را فراهم می‌کند. این کتابخانه از بیش از 70 فرمت فایل، از جمله PDF، Word، Excel و PowerPoint پشتیبانی می‌کند و جستجوهای دقیق و کارآمدی را تضمین می‌کند.
بیشتر بیاموزید
About illustration

برای شروع آماده اید؟

GroupDocs.Search را به صورت رایگان دانلود کنید یا یک مجوز آزمایشی برای دسترسی کامل دریافت کنید!

منابع مفید

برای ارتقاء تجربه خود ، مستندات ، نمونه های کد و پشتیبانی جامعه را کاوش کنید.

عملکردهای کلیدی

جستجوهای سریع و دقیقی را در اسناد انجام دهید.

جستجو در فرمت‌های مختلف سند

GroupDocs.Search از بیش از 70 نوع فایل پشتیبانی می‌کند و امکان جستجوی مؤثر متن را در انواع اسناد اداری و تجاری فراهم می‌کند.

نکات مجوز موقت

1
با ایمیل کاری خود ثبت نام کنید. خدمات پست الکترونیکی رایگان مجاز نیستند.
2
در مرحله دوم از دکمه دریافت مجوز موقت استفاده کنید.
 فارسی